Present: all heads of department; apologies from Operations. The principal item was the possible acquisition of Redmarsh Analytics, a data-tooling firm based in Otterfield. Due diligence findings were presented: revenues growing 18% annually, but key-person risk noted around its founder. Legal flagged two outstanding contract disputes as manageable. The board has asked for a valuation range by month end. Discussion was recorded as strictly confidential, and the agreed position is set out below.

confidential, kagup-bafog: Fraaxax Group is in early talks to buy Soroxox Group for about $343.8 million. The Olidor launch date is June 14, and nothing goes to the press before then. Legal wants the Aldmirek Logistics term sheet signed before July 23.

Visitor Policy — Data Centre Cage Visits, Stennick Park Facility

Visiting contractors attending cage C-4 must sign in at the security lodge and remain escorted at all times. Tools must be declared on arrival; photography is prohibited inside the data hall. Your escort will take you through the man-trap to the cage corridor. At the cage gate keypad, enter the contractor code below.

staff pass of haweg-bafop = bdg-G-69

**Off-site run — Hallowmere Testing Centre intake**

Heads up, team: the sealed exam papers for the Brightfen Certificate sitting arrive Thursday morning via Quickhart Couriers. Don't stack anything on the intake bench before 8:30 — we need it clear. Check the tamper seals are intact before signing anything, and keep the papers in the locked annexe until Marla from Invigilation collects them. If a seal looks dodgy, refuse the whole consignment. The hand-over itself must follow the confidential instruction below.

handover note for yagef-bagep: the drudor pelius courier leaves the kasdor zorvan norir ledger at gate 8016 under passcode 755406

Runbook: Scanline barcode bridge

If warehouse scans stop flowing into Cartwheel, it's almost always the bridge service on the Dunmore floor box wedging after a USB hiccup. Bounce the service first — nine times out of ten that fixes it. If not, check the queue depth before escalating. When restarting, make sure the bridge comes up with these settings.

deployment values, yafop-bajef:
[gilok]
team = ulaius
access_code = ac_423664
host = gilok.sivrelhq.corp
port = 9200
owner = pelius.istax
peer = eliok.torvasoft.internal